Ludacris Talks LL Cool J, Upcoming Mixtape, New Generation Of Rappers [Video]

Exclusive interview with Ludacris. In part 1 Luda talks to Nick Huff Barili about how LL Cool J’s track I’m Bad made him want to start rapping. Ludacris wrote his first rhyme at 9 years old about…his girlfriend. He goes on to say that when he is constructing a song he lets the beat create an atmosphere for how he feels and then he writes to the emotion of that. As we switch topics Luda talks about his upcoming mixtape which is dropping this friday (May 24th). Luda explains why he chose to called it “I don’t give a fuck”. One of the track from the leaked track-listing that has people talking is “Mad For” which features Chris Brown, Meek Mill and Pusha T all of whom along with Luda have had some things to say about Drake. Luda states that he was not aware that everyone on the track had issues with Drake and that he does not tell other rappers what to write about on his tracks. He goes on to say that his verse on the track in not directed at anyone in particular. Luda is releasing the mixtape for free to flood the streets with new music and to let everyone know that music is still number 1 to him regardless of him shooting a couple movies. Ludacris says that he loves the new generation of rappers, how people are creating their own lanes and growing their own underground movements before major labels even get involved.

Madlib – The Mad March [Audio]

Madlib last visited San Francisco in December 2011 to debut his collaboration with Freddie Gibbs. For his return to the Bay Area, he’s put together an evening focusing on one of his favorite musical scenes from the lost but not forgotten past: the Southern African nation of Zambia’s vibrant 70s rock scene. This is the Sound of Zamrock. Madlib has championed Zamrock’s heroes on his Beat Konducta in Africa (sampling from the likes of WITCH and Paul Ngozi); his DJ sets feature rarities from the scene; he and the rapper formerly known as Mos Def have been discussing a trip to Zambia to record a collaborative album. At this special Madlib Medicine Show, Madlib will put together a DJ set that weaves his trademark hip-hop beats with Zamrock classics. He’s also brought WITCH’s last remaining member, bandleader Emmanuel “Jagari” Chanda from Zambia to San Francisco to perform Zamrock Live for the first time to a public audience in North America. Rounding out the bill is Now-Again Records’ Egon, Madlib’s partner in Madlib Invazion, and the man behind the resurgence of interest in the Zamrock movement.
